DOM উপাদানের তথ্য পাওয়া জাভাস্ক্রিপ্টে
ডিস্ট্রাকচারিং আমাদের DOM-এর টেক্সট এবং অ্যাট্রিবিউটের মান সরাসরি লুপে পেতে দেয়। আসুন বুঝে নিই এটি কিভাবে কাজ করে। ধরি আমাদের নিম্নলিখিত প্যারাগ্রাফ আছে:
<p id="id1">text1</p>
<p id="id2">text2</p>
<p id="id3">text3</p>
আসুন এই প্যারাগ্রাফগুলোর কালেকশন একটি ভেরিয়েবলে পাই:
let elems = document.querySelectorAll('p');
নম্বর এবং উপাদানগুলো আলাদা করে এলিমেন্টগুলো লুপ করে দেখা যাক:
for (let [key, elem] of elems.entries()) {
console.log(key, elem);
}
এবার আসুন ডিস্ট্রাকচারিং
করি, তাদের থেকে তাদের id এবং
টেক্সট পেয়ে যাই:
for (let [key, {id, textContent}] of elems.entries()){
console.log(key, id, textContent);
}
নিম্নলিখিত কোড দেওয়া আছে:
<input id="id1" value="111">
<input id="id2" value="222">
<input id="id3" value="333">
ইনপুটগুলোর নম্বর, id এবং value পান।